So who did what?

he did the cool stuff. :)

ugly supplied a jmy synth track. i gave it a listen, then got bogged down with real life. weeks later i did a pass with electric bass and pedals. i used my live panning stereo setup.

first piece (in order of recording): his drony stuff starts things off, i come in with a small looped thing on the ct5 into charlie foxtrot and then do a bunch of fuzz and other noise and do small loops of that on the boomerang three. then i pull the loops in and out.

second piece: i sent him a thing of me putting stuff in the strings (see my avatar for what i mean), plus other stuff.

this is one of those things where i'm using the three different elements with exp pedals and different eq curves to create different textures.

So who did what?
On the one I sent him its just one jmt synth track.

In the one he sent me I played a jmt synth and contact mic sounds\percussion.
(Items used: a metal file, pliars, a can of sparkling water, paper clips and a truss rod tool....)

Then I mixed everything in Ableton.
Only EQ and reverb where added in the daw.
I adjusted the levels and did a pseudo mastering.
(EQ'ing was to make space for each part as much as possible)
